#e6068f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e6068f is composed of 90.2% red, 2.4% green and 56.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 97.4% magenta, 37.8% yellow and 9.8% black. It has a hue angle of 323.3 degrees, a saturation of 94.9% and a lightness of 46.3%. #e6068f color hex could be obtained by blending #ff0cff with #cd001f. Closest websafe color is: #ff0099.

#e6068f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#e6068f has RGB values of R:230, G:6, B:143 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.97, Y:0.38, K:0.1. Its decimal value is 15074959.

Hex triplet e6068f #e6068f
RGB Decimal 230, 6, 143 rgb(230,6,143)
RGB Percent 90.2, 2.4, 56.1 rgb(90.2%,2.4%,56.1%)
CMYK 0, 97, 38, 10
HSL 323.3°, 94.9, 46.3 hsl(323.3,94.9%,46.3%)
HSV (or HSB) 323.3°, 97.4, 90.2
Web Safe ff0099 #ff0099
CIE-LAB 50.617, 80.087, -11.805
XYZ 37.657, 18.94, 27.658
xyY 0.447, 0.225, 18.94
CIE-LCH 50.617, 80.952, 351.615
CIE-LUV 50.617, 114.709, -31.036
Hunter-Lab 43.521, 78.29, -7.215
Binary 11100110, 00000110, 10001111

Shades and Tints of #e6068f

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010000 is the darkest color, while #ffecf8 is the lightest one.

Color Blindness Simulator

Below, you can see how #e6068f is perceived by people affected by a color vision deficiency. This can be useful if you need to ensure your color combinations are accessible to color-blind users.

Monochromacy
  • #595959 Achromatopsia 0.005% of the population
  • #754864 Atypical Achromatopsia 0.001% of the population
Dichromacy
  • #607dc6 Protanopia 1% of men
  • #887c85 Deuteranopia 1% of men
  • #e24143 Tritanopia 0.001% of the population
Trichromacy
  • #9051b2 Protanomaly 1% of men, 0.01% of women
  • #aa5189 Deuteranomaly 6% of men, 0.4% of women
  • #e32b5e Tritanomaly 0.01% of the population
